 | | Mariah Carey bans fans from hugging her |
Mariah Carey banned fans from hugging her at the New York launch of her new
perfume M.
The pop diva's most devoted supporters paid $300 for "VIP access" which
allowed them to pose for a personal photograph with Mariah - as long as they
didn't get too close, at the fragrance launch in Macy's department store.
One source said: "Mimi wouldn't let her male admirers put their arms around
her waist during picture time - and absolutely no hugs.
"One young guy tried to get to close and was quickly shown to the exit."
The crowds gathered outside the store to catch a glimpse of Mariah - who
arrived in a Rolls Royce - were so huge that a heavy police presence was
drafted in to hold them back.
Around 200 fans were allowed into the store to pay $130 for a bottle of
marshmallow scented M in the 'Hero' singer's presence, while 75 forked out
the extra money for VIP access.
Mariah was seen politely speaking to two female fans who were proudly
showing off elaborate M tattoos on their wrists, which they had had done in
tribute to Mariah.
